Output 6621077675b5933c4ff92aa281ee4c93fea778dbd7c8e9ab40dfaeca66f36293:0

value
3238238
script pubkey
OP_HASH160 OP_PUSHBYTES_20 560d729960fb1c08cb25e7fc8ca1b62d2e300a58 OP_EQUAL
address
39Y29QBSZt6tETSvKR9fmWgnEE8Tn44tDm
transaction
6621077675b5933c4ff92aa281ee4c93fea778dbd7c8e9ab40dfaeca66f36293
spent
true